In a notice to the state, the office furniture company says closure will result in the layoffs of nearly 500 employees in the Orange County town.
The company says the layoffs of 467 workers are expected to be permanent. Employees will be terminated beginning in January with most of the layoffs taking place between March and October of 2017.
Paoli did not disclose a reason for the closure of the plant.
